What is palliative surgery for gastric cancer? Relieve the patient's symptoms

The purpose of palliative surgery for gastric cancer is to relieve the patient's symptoms. In gastric cancer patients, if there is obstruction or bleeding, palliative surgery is usually used. Palliative surgery for gastric cancer includes palliative total gastrectomy, palliative subtotal gastrectomy, gastrojejunostomy, jejunostomy, etc., to improve the patient's quality of life, but it cannot prolong the patient's survival and is not conducive to the treatment of gastric cancer.

Gastric cancer surgery includes radical surgery and palliative surgery. Radical surgery refers to the radical removal of the tumor in the stomach. So, what is palliative surgery for gastric cancer?
Palliative surgery for gastric cancer refers to the situation that some patients with gastric cancer cannot completely remove the gastric cancer. If they have symptoms such as bleeding and pain, they must undergo palliative surgery to relieve the symptoms. At this time, the patient's prognosis is still very poor, and only some symptoms can be relieved to a certain extent. Other patients have pyloric obstruction and other complications, and can only undergo simple anastomosis.
Palliative surgery refers to surgery that cannot be radically removed, but is performed only because of complications of gastric cancer that must be treated surgically. The purpose is to relieve the patient's pain and prolong the patient's survival. For example, palliative gastrostomy or gastrojejunostomy or jejunostomy can be performed for incurable gastric cardia cancer or obstructive gastric antrum cancer. For incurable gastric cancer perforation, palliative perforation repair or palliative subtotal gastrectomy can be performed.
Palliative gastric cancer resection refers to surgical removal of the tumor, but there is still residual tumor in the body. Surgery only reduces the tumor burden of the body and cannot completely remove the tumor. This palliative resection can also reduce the occurrence of serious complications such as bleeding, perforation, and obstruction. In addition to palliative resection, palliative gastric cancer surgery also includes gastrostomy, enterostomy, gastrojejunostomy, and gastric diaphragm. These are not radical surgeries for gastric cancer.
